模板:NBA Year
本模板含有複雜而精密的擴展語法。 編輯本模板前,建議您先熟悉解析器函數與本模板的設計思路、運作原理等。若您的編輯引發了意外的問題,請儘快撤銷編輯,因為本模板可能被大量頁面使用。 您所作的編輯可先在模板沙盒或您的個人頁面中進行測試。 |
用法
使用此模板可快速以不同樣式連結至各個NBA賽季頁面,輸入至模板裡的數字將為該球季的首年份,預設出現的結果為「yyyy-yy」的格式,但是為了符合維基百科對年份書寫的要求格式,1999-00 NBA賽季的模板預設顯示結果為「1999–2000」。
{{NBAY|...}}
和{{nbay|...}}
均重定向至此模板,因此可在編寫頁面時使用這兩個模板縮寫名。
樣式參數
- app
- 可在年份後方加上任意文字,文字本身也會被括進內部連結,但不可只輸入空格。
- nolink
- 賽季年份不作維基百科的內部轉換。
- full
- 年份會顯示為「yyyy–yyyy」的全展樣式。
- trunc
- 針對1999-00 NBA賽季的特殊格式而設,可用來將1999–2000的20截去,成為1999–00的簡短樣式。
範例
{{NBA Year|1999}}
→ 1999–2000{{NBA Year|1999|app=年好精彩的NBA球季}}
→ 1999–2000 年好精彩的NBA球季{{NBA Year|1999|start}}
→ 1999{{NBA Year|1999|end}}
→ 2000{{NBA Year|1999|trunc=y}}
→ 1999–00{{NBA Year|1999|nolink=y|trunc=y}}
→ 1999–00
{{NBA Year|1998}}
→ 1998–99{{NBA Year|1998|full=y}}
→ 1998–1999{{NBA Year|1998|full=y|nolink=y}}
→ 1998–1999
錯誤範例
- 在參數後方只可加上「=y」,代表啟動其對應樣式,若填入其他符號並無意義,且會造成語法和顯示結果產生矛盾,例如:
{{NBA Year|1999|nolink=NO}}
→ 1999–2000
- 參數
full
和trunc
的互相排斥,例如:
{{NBA Year|1999|full=y|trunc=y}}
→ 1999–2000
- 參數
start
/end
和nolink
互不相容,例如:
{{NBA Year|1999|start|nolink=y}}
→ 1999–2000
- 參數
trunc
對1999年以外的起始年份無用,因其他賽季的預設顯示已經為簡短模式,例如:
{{NBA Year|1998|trunc=y}}
→ 1998–99
- 參數
full
對1999年的起始年份無用,因為其預設顯示已經為全展模式,例如:
{{NBA Year|1999|full=y}}
→ 1999–2000